## Tailing logs with stripefeed

Plugin authors should use the `stripefeed tail` subcommand rather than reading log files directly, as the Lanternworks platform rotates logs without notice. Pass `--channel` with your plugin's registered channel name; omit it to stream the default firehose, which is rate-limited for external consumers.

If output stalls for more than thirty seconds, restart the tail with `--resume` to pick up from the last checkpoint. When filing a stall report, include the trace token printed below.

build token for tawip-yageg: htk9_92ac43d42

## Deployment

The Pingwell reminder job runs nightly and texts patients of the Oakmere Clinic network about next-day appointments. Deploys are boring on purpose: push to the release branch, the runner builds the container, and the scheduler picks up the new image at the top of the hour. One gotcha — the job refuses to start if the quiet-hours window is unset, so don't blank it out "temporarily." When you deploy, make sure the environment carries these values.

settings of hahif-tagaf:
CASION_PIN=2161
CASION_TENANT=lamael
CASION_METRICS_HOST=metrics.casion.urlaqsoft.internal
CASION_SEAL=seal_a7b908e4
CASION_STANDBY_TEAM=casdor

### Account Recovery — Catalogue Import (Lintwood)

Quick one for review: when the Lintwood catalogue import wipes a patron's session table, the recovery flow re-seeds accounts from the nightly snapshot. Check that the importer skips locked accounts — last time it didn't. To rerun recovery against staging you'll need the vault passphrase, which is appended just below.

recovery phrase for yafof-tajof: julmir-kelax-julvan-holath-belvan-holir-ralael-ralvan-ralath-julvan-silmir-istmir-kaswyn-ulamir

## Authentication

Matchbox (the pairing service) exposes GC pause metrics at `/internal/gc`. Pauses over 400ms page on-call. The endpoint is behind the Kestrelgate proxy; anonymous calls return 403. Auth is a static service key in the `X-Matchbox-Key` header — no OAuth, no refresh. Keys rotate quarterly; stale keys fail closed, which looks identical to a network partition, so check auth first. The current on-call key for the GC metrics endpoint is below.

API key for kahap-faduf: vxb23-Ir087IkWYmBJt7KRtkyhUA3